Next-gen telecom tech to get ₹1,000 crore yearly R&D boost

Mint27-05-2025

Research and development (R&D) on new telecom technologies will be a key focus area in the draft five-year National Telecom Policy 2025-2030, according to policy draft seen by Mint.
The Centre government is targeting spends of ₹1,000 crore per year–compared to just ₹400 crore in FY26–to support research in new technologies like 5G/6G, quantum communications, blockchain, and satellite communication, as part of the upcoming policy.
The policy, currently in draft stage, will be notified soon by the department of telecommunications (DoT), an official said on the condition of anonymity.
An improvement in R&D spends will help the country reduce its dependence on telecom equipment imports. However, going by previous years, the annual budget allocation for R&D has been unutilised, as per the Union budget documents.
Overall, India's current R&D spending is low compared to other countries. Compared to the the global average of 2.6%, the Economic Survey 2025 pointed out that India spends just 0.64% of its GDP on R&D.
In a bid to push startups and industries towards new technologies, two funds–Telecom Software Development Fund and Sovereign Patent Fund–would be established to create a patent pool for widely used telecom technologies and promote India's telecom and networking software, according to the draft of the upcoming policy.
The new policy would come at a time when satellite communications is emerging as a new technology area in the country with firms such as Starlink, Eutelsat OneWeb, Amazon's Kuiper, among others. Further, quantum communications, which offer high-security communication channels, is also getting traction in the country. Further, the government has a target to lead in 6G and get 10% global share in 6G-related patents.
'With the advent of transformative technologies such as 5G, Artificial Intelligence (AI), the Internet of Things (IoT), blockchain, and quantum computing, the world is witnessing unprecedented shifts in how economies function, and societies interact. These advancements present India with an unparalleled opportunity to bridge the digital divide, empower underserved populations, and drive equitable growth," DoT said in the policy draft, which is currently undergoing industry consultations.
Queries emailed to DoT did not elicit any response till press time.

'We are among the top six countries today that are filing for 6G patents. We have built one of the most robust telecommunication networks and systems across the world which is cutting edge, customer-oriented and service-oriented," communications minister Jyotiraditya Scindia said on Monday at the theme launch event of India Mobile Congress (IMC) 2025. 'While we talk about opportunities such as this, innovation has to be at the core of our existence."
The government will meet its R&D investments from the ₹86,356-crore Digital Bharat Nidhi (DBN) Fund, the official cited above said. Besides, the focus will also be to ask the private sector to boost R&D investments.
'India's gross expenditure on R&D is significantly lower than the global average. This is a long-standing bottleneck in achieving leadership in sectors like telecom…The focus on innovation will encourage and enable startups, academia, and industry to develop indigenous solutions and next-gen telecom technologies," said Harsh Walia, partner at Khaitan & Co.
'Through better connectivity, citizens will gain access to digital education, telehealth, digital payments, and other online services that improve quality of life. Affordable and high-speed internet in remote and underserved regions will reduce digital divide," Walia said, adding that the government may also introduce 'R&D-linked Production-Linked Incentive' schemes to incentivize firms undertaking domestic innovation alongside manufacturing.
The upcoming telecom policy
Under the policy, the government is targeting to promote 1,000 tech startups and micro, small and medium enterprises (MSMEs) in the telecom sector in emerging technologies. The plan is to also establish 10 centres of excellence for R&D and commercialization of emerging telecom technologies.
Besides, a new experimental authorisation for the spectrum in the 95 GHz to 3 THz range will be issued. 'Authorisation and assignment-exempt operations to be permitted in the 116-123 GHz, 174.8-182 GHz, 185-190 GHz, and 244-246 GHz frequency bands or parts thereof in India. 77-81 GHz frequency range to be opened for authorisation and assignment-exempt operations of automotive radar systems in India," the draft policy said.
Besides focusing on R&D and innovation, the upcoming telecom policy will focus on five other strategic missions - universal and meaningful connectivity, domestic manufacturing, secure and trusted telecom network, ease of living and ease of doing business, and sustainable telecom, as per the draft policy.
With regard to domestic manufacturing, the government aims to increase domestic manufacturing output in the telecom sector by 100% with significant increase in localization across products. In addition, the target is to double India's export contribution towards the global telecom and network product market and reduce import of telecommunication equipment by 50%.

The telecom equipment sales under the production linked incentive stood at ₹80,927 crore. Out of this, the exports were at ₹14,838 crore.
According to a 2024 report by NITI Aayog, more than 40% of the telecom equipment such as 4G/5G signal processing units and antenna, are imported from China.
'There needs to be an import substitution of telecommunication equipment by 100% during 2025-2030 period with products which are designed, developed and manufactured in India," said Rakesh Bhatnagar, director general of VoICE (Voice of Indian Commtech Enterprises), which represents local telecom solution providers.
According to Bhatnagar, there is a need for updating the draft version of National Telecom Policy 2025 after Operation Sindoor to reduce dependence on other countries for chips, operating systems and software.
The policy has proposed incentivising telecom operators using indigenously designed and manufactured equipment, to ensure self-reliance and promoting domestic R&D.
'Local R&D builds strategic autonomy, reduces import reliance, and enhances national security. It delivers India-specific, cost-effective solutions suited to rural gaps and diversity. It drives deep-tech jobs, fuels startups, and boosts economic growth," said Vinish Bawa, partner and telecom sector leader at PwC India.
To succeed, the government must promote public-private R&D partnerships, incentivize private investment through tax breaks and co-funding, and enable faster approvals, he said.
Periodic audits
For safe and trusted networks, the government will conduct periodic cybersecurity audits of telecom networks to assess resilience to threats to telecom cyber security. A National Telecom SafeNet will be established to protect the national telecom network, the draft policy said.
To enhance security measures, the government will roll out secured unified communication and quantum secure video phones for the government and states. It will promote end-point security for telecom network devices (except mobile, laptop, desktop etc.) by deployment of indigenous endpoint detection & response solutions, according to the draft policy.
Earlier, the government had come out with a digital communications policy for the period 2018-22. The 2018-22 policy replaced the National Telecom Policy announced in 2012.

The 2018 policy had set targets to provide universal broadband connectivity, increase the digital communications sector's contribution to GDP to 8% from 6% in 2017, create 4 million jobs, and fiberization of at least 60% of towers, among other areas, by 2022. According to industry executives, in some of the areas such as public Wi-Fi hotspots, tower fiberization, targets for BharatNet connectivity, and home broadband penetration, the progress has been slow.
In the new draft policy, the government aims to achieve fiberization of towers from 43% to 80%. The government had set a target to achieve 70% tower fiberization by FY25. Tower fiberization refers to the process of connecting mobile towers to high-speed fiber-optic networks.
Over the next five years, the government plans to enable provision of fixed line broadband network from 45 million to 100 million households in the country, deploy 1 million public Wi-Fi hotspots, and use community Wi-Fi networks as an alternative for last mile connectivity. The government is targeting to create 1 million new jobs (direct and indirect) in the telecom products and services sector.

Kacheguda Station to get a dazzling makeover from today

Hyderabad: The historic Kacheguda Railway Station is set to wear an illuminated look on Monday, as Union Minister G Kishan Reddy will be inaugurating its new facade lighting system. This initiative, funded by the Union Ministry of Tourism with an investment of Rs 2.23 crore, aims to highlight the architectural beauty and cultural importance of heritage buildings. Kishan Reddy emphasised the government's commitment to enhancing the visual appeal of such structures, allowing the public to better appreciate their historical significance. Kacheguda Railway Station, built in 1916 during the Nizam era and featuring a distinctive Gothic architectural style, is now adorned with 785 lighting fixtures. These lights are expected to accentuate the station's majestic design and heritage charm, particularly after dusk. Situated centrally within the city and serving thousands of passengers daily, the newly lit-up station is set to become a cultural and visual landmark. The enhanced lighting will also help visitors understand and appreciate the station's rich historical importance. Beyond its heritage value, Kacheguda Railway Station is also a beacon of green infrastructure. It has been awarded the Platinum Rating by the Indian Green Building Council (IGBC) for its dedication to environmental sustainability through green energy use. Additionally, it holds recognition as an Energy-Efficient Station by Indian Railways and was notably the first station in Indian Railways to introduce digital payment systems. Looking ahead, the station is earmarked for significant redevelopment under the Amrit Bharat Station Scheme. An investment of Rs 421.66 crore has been allocated to improve passenger facilities while ensuring the preservation of its iconic legacy.

Satcom permit may force Starlink to share information on illegal kits seized

New Delhi: Elon Musk's Starlink's satcom permit from the Indian government will make it mandatory for the company to share information, including details of users or owners of satellite kits seized in the country, particularly in the North-East region in the past few months, information the US company was unwilling to share security agencies have pointed out the misuse of Starlink devices in Indian territory, especially in the border areas, officials the Musk company hasn't been cooperating in sharing details of those devices. Officials said Starlink asked the security agencies to put their requests either via the US law enforcement or international protocols. This had forced the Ministry of Home Affairs (MHA) to write to the Department of Telecommunications (DoT) in March to investigate the matter, officials aware of the details told ET. The DoT is yet to submit a report to the MHA. But officials say, now that a satcom license has been given to Starlink, it will have no choice but to share those details. Else, the company could be issued a show cause notice and even face revocation of license. An ET query sent to SpaceX, parent of Starlink, remained unanswered at the time of going to press. Various ministries coordinate when it comes to national security. Since commercial satellite communication services, particularly through low earth orbit (LEO) operators like Starlink, is a new phenomenon, its impact is yet to be ascertained. However, the security agencies have seized some terminals that were active in the Indian territory in the Northeast region and sought details of the owners. The DoT was asked to investigate the matter and take preventive measures to safeguard national interests. Experts believe that the situation may become more complicated as Bhutan and Bangladesh are now commercially offering Starlink services and the terminals may be smuggled into Indian territory as geofencing the exact location of the international border will have limitations. Security is topmost priority when it comes to satcom and so far, none of the three licensees - Bharti group-backer Eutelsat OneWeb, Reliance Jio-SES and Starlink - have got security clearances, hobbling commercial services. While Eutelsat OneWeb and Jio-SES joint ventures have got trial spectrum and conducted demonstrations for security requirements, Starlink is yet to be given such airwaves. The US company was given a Global Mobile Personal Communication by Satellite (GMPCS) permit only last week. Officials said while the Jio-SES demonstrations are almost over, it is expected to take more time for Eutelsat-OneWeb. Both OneWeb and Jio-SES have satcom permits and nods from space regulator Indian National Space Promotion and Authorization Centre (IN-SPACe) for over two years. In contrast, Starlink is yet to receive the nod from the space regulator. The rules require satcom license holders to monitor all traffic, establish satellite earth station gateways, set up a control and monitoring centre in India, and all the traffic originating or terminating in India shall pass through Indian gateways. The companies are also required to create buffer zones along the international order. 'In case of violation of the license conditions, the licensor (DoT) may take suitable action including suspension, revocation or termination of the license and imposition of financial penalty on the licensee,' said a government official. As per reports, in December last year, Starlink devices, along with weapons and ammunition, were seized in Manipur by security agencies. In another instance, there was recovery of an illegal Starlink device in the Andaman and Nicobar Islands. In 2021, Starlink found itself against the Indian law when it started accepting bookings and receiving advance payments for services to be offered in India without any authorisation from the government. The DoT had then directed Starlink to refrain from doing so and issued an advisory to citizens. Starlink was forced to rescind the bookings and make refunds.

5-km tunnel to link Mahipalpur to Mandela Marg, Delhi CM Rekha Gupta announces approval; check design and structure here

NEW DELHI: Chief minister Rekha Gupta said on Sunday that the national capital was reaping the benefits of the double-engine govt as the Centre had approved a plan for a 5-km tunnel that is expected to balance traffic between south Delhi and NCR. The tunnel, from Shiv Murti-Mahipalpur (Dwarka expressway) to Nelson Mandela Road (Vasant Kunj), will reduce congestion on multiple routes and create a signal-free corridor. The CM said that after a recent meeting with Union minister Nitin Gadkari, projects worth Rs 24,000 crore that are aimed at streamlining traffic and reducing pollution in Delhi and its adjoining areas, were approved. Among them is the 5-kilometre tunnel, which will be constructed by the National Highways Authority of India (NHAI) at an estimated cost of Rs 3,500 crore. The tunnel will have two underground tubes - one each for up and down traffic. Each tube will have three lanes. The tunnel will also have electro-mechanical systems, ventilation, fire safety, CCTV surveillance, control rooms, emergency exits and cross-passages. South Delhi MP Ramvir Singh Bidhuri said that the tunnel will be a blessing for people in the area as it will offer a direct, signal-free atlernative between south Delhi, Dwarka and Gurgaon. The tunnel is expected to help in eliminating traffic jams on NH-48 during peak hours. This tunnel will be a key connector between central/east Delhi and multiple major expressways and highways, including the Delhi Expressway (NE-5), NH-44, NH-10, Delhi-Jaipur Highway (NH-48), and Delhi-Dehradun Expressway (NH-709B) via the Urban Extension Road (UER) and Dwarka Expressway, Bidhuri said. This will lead to smoother traffic across these routes and a significant reduction in pollution levels, he added. The chief minister said that all technical and formal requirements for the project are in their final stages, and work is expected to start early next year. Calling this project the "foundation for the Delhi of the future," Gupta said that the tunnel will give a new direction to Delhi's infrastructure and bring relief to millions. "We are committed to making Delhi congestion-free and clean," she said. The tunnel project ends at the upcoming intersection at Shiv Murti on the Delhi-Gurgaon Expressway. Officials said those heading towards Gurgaon can take the left turn to join the expressway, while others can seamlessly get on to the Dwarka Expressway to head towards Manesar or Chandigarh.
